Consultant tells Garland council revitalization strategy: focus, not scatter; demo house will test Chapter 380 incentives

Summary

A CZB housing analysis urged Garland to prioritize geographically targeted reinvestment rather than scattering resources citywide; staff will use a newly acquired demonstration house to test incentive design for a bounded Chapter 380 program.

Consultant CZB told Garland council on Nov. 3 that the city faces a structurally challenged housing market: lower than regional prices but a significant share of households that still cannot meet local housing costs.

Key findings: CZB mapped the city into submarkets and concluded the most leverageable public investments are geographically targeted — focusing on legacy neighborhoods nearest downtown and key nodes along Garland Avenue, Bridal and Northwest corridors.
